WebbThe Coefficient of Discharge is the ratio of experimentally discharge record to theoretical discharge derived via formulae. In the venturi meter, the value of the discharge coefficient can be up to 0.98, which is relatively high and nears the maximum achievable value of 1. Webb23 sep. 2024 · A discharge coefficient cd = 0.975 can be indicated as standard, but the value varies noticeably at low values of the Reynolds number. What is the coefficient of discharge for a Venturi meter? The discharge coefficient of a Venturi meter is typically 0.985, but may be even higher if the convergent section is machined.
